Brick Hardscaping in West Hartford,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design and installation of durable, visually appealing features made from brick materials. These projects often include constructing pat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and garden borders that enhance both the functionality and aesthetics of a property. Homeowners typically seek these services to create outdoor living spaces, improve curb appeal, or add structural elements that define different areas of their yard.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, existing landscape conditions, and the style or pattern of brickwork they prefer, ensuring the finished project complements the overall property design.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ects can help homeowners plan effectively. It's important to know the types of brick and mortar used, as well as the maintenance requirements for these features. Property owners often want to clarify the durability and longevity of brick structures, especially in areas prone to weather variations. Additionally, considering drainage, slope, and integration with existing landscaping can influence the success of the project. Clear communication about these aspects can aid in achieving a durable, attractive result that meets the property's needs and aesthetic preferences.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, garden borders, and retaining walls around residential properties.
How durable is brick for outdoor hardscaping?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ather and foot traffic, making it suitable for long-lasting outdoor features.
Can brick hardscaping match existing landscape elements? Yes, brick can be integrated with other materials and styles to complement existing landscape features.
What maintenance is required for brick hardscaping? Regular cleaning and occasional repointing help maintain the appearance and integrity of brick features.
